The deadline for arts categories is 17:00 on November 5th, and the deadline for non-arts categories is 17:00 on November 15th.
The provincial unified examination for art majors includes art, music (divided into vocal music and instrumental music, candidates can choose one), director and production, calligraphy, broadcasting and hosting, performance and dance (divided into Candidates can choose either art dance or international standard dance), and art candidates must choose one of the categories to apply.
Art, music, directing and production, and calligraphy are not allowed to be applied concurrently; when registering for the exam, any one of these four categories can be applied concurrently with other art categories, and other art categories can also be applied together. Also reported. Detailed regulations are subject to the art admissions documents.
The unified art examination will be held on November 26, 2022.
The music unified examination time is from 8:30 to 10:30 on November 26, 2022.
The unified examination for broadcasting and hosting will be conducted in batches starting from January 5, 2023.
The unified examination time for directors will be from 8:30 to 11:30 on November 26, 2022;
The unified examination time for performances will be conducted in batches starting from January 4, 2023.
The unified calligraphy examination will be held on November 26, 2022.
The dance unified examination will be held in batches starting from November 29, 2022.
